5:59Now PlayingHealth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r. on Monday announced he had removed every member of a scientific committee that advises the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ention on how to use vaccines and pledged to replace them with his own picks.
He claimed the committee had too many conflicts of interest and plans to appoint new members.
The panel's work has been in limbo since Kennedy took office, including a delayed February meeting.
